Adenosine deaminases that act on RNA, then and now
1Department of Biochemistry, University of Utah, Salt Lake City, Utah 84112, USA bbass@biochem.utah.edu.
Abstract:
In this article, I recount my memories of key experiments that led to my entry into the RNA editing/modification field. I highlight initial observations made by the pioneers in the ADAR field, and how they fit into our current understanding of this family of enzymes. I discuss early mysteries that have now been solved, as well as those that still linger. Finally, I discuss important, outstanding questions and acknowledge my hope for the future of the RNA editing/modification field.
